A woman, invited as a guest of honor in an online graduation ceremony in Dasmariñas, Cavite was caught off-guard after being exposed for allegedly faking her credentials from the University of the Philippines Manila (UPM). 

A certain Kathleen Joy R. Poblete was invited as a guest speaker in the graduation ceremony of Ramona S. Tirona Memorial High School in Dasmariñas City last July 15. 



Poblete claimed she is currently enrolled in the UP Manila College of Law and a recipient of the Juris Doctor’s award and the Best in Research award. She also claimed she was a Summa Cum Laude graduate of UPM’s Political Science program—showing inaccuracy as the University's graduation is set on August 22. 

Her introduction included taking up a Bachelor of Arts in Political Science at Cavite State University where she was supposedly a consistent college scholar and dean’s lister.

The introduction also claimed that Poblete was able to study at UP Manila (junior year college) through the help of Cavite State University where she earned first honors with an average grade of 1.015.

Poblete, in her make-believe credentials, also shared a proof of her "virtual graduation," which shows inconsistencies in her claim as it contains the logo of UP Diliman in the upper right and UP Manila Political Science Program in the lower right corner. 

Concurrently, the Department of Social Sciences and the Political Science Program of UP Manila in a statement released Tuesday, has “categorically denied any affiliations with Poblete."



The University clarified that neither of the said awards were given by the Department of Social Sciences nor is she currently studying in the College of Law as it only exists in UP Diliman. 

They also emphasized that "there has only been one Summa Cum Laude from the UP Manila Political Science Program—Ms. Georgina Mia B. Gato—who graduated in 2019." 
  
The Office of the University Registrar further confirmed that Poblete has no records of  ever attending the University. 

On the same bid, Cavite State University in a statement, revealed that Poblete was neither a college scholar nor a dean's lister and "has been enrolled in (its) AB Political Science Program for three semesters only, AY 2018-2019 and First Semester of 2019-2020." 

It added that Poblete has not requested any official documents regarding her transfer to another university or school.
